Landscape Drainage Repair Services
Landscape drainage repair involves fixing issues related to the movement and management of excess water in outdoor spaces. This service typically includes assessing existing drainage systems, repairing or replacing damaged components, and installing new solutions to improve water flow. Proper drainage helps prevent water from pooling in unwanted areas, which can cause damage to lawns, gardens, walkways, and structures. Professionals often evaluate the terrain, soil type, and existing drainage infrastructure to determine the most effective approach for restoring proper water management.
Addressing drainage problems can resolve a variety of issues that affect property stability and appearance. Poor drainage can lead to soil erosion, foundation problems, and landscape deterioration. Excess water pooling can also create muddy patches or soggy lawns that hinder outdoor activities and plant growth. By repairing or upgrading drainage systems, property owners can mitigate these concerns, reducing the risk of long-term damage and maintaining a healthier, more functional outdoor environment.
These services are commonly used on residential properties, including single-family homes, as well as commercial sites with landscaped areas. Properties with sloped yards, gardens, or areas prone to poor water runoff often benefit from drainage repairs. Additionally, properties near bodies of water or with high rainfall levels are more likely to require professional drainage solutions to manage water flow effectively and prevent flooding or water accumulation.
Professionals offering landscape drainage repair services utilize a variety of techniques depending on the specific needs of each property. Common methods include installing or repairing French drains, surface drains, catch basins, and sump pumps. They may also address grading issues to ensure proper slope and runoff direction. The overview below groups typical Landscape Drainage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in York County, SC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Repair Costs - The cost for landscape drainage repairs typically ranges from $1,000 to $5,000, depending on the extent of the damage and system complexity. For example, replacing a damaged drain pipe might cost around $1,200, while extensive repairs could reach $4,800. Variations are common based on the scope of work and local rates.
Material Expenses - Material costs for drainage repair services usually fall between $300 and $1,500, influenced by the type of materials used such as pipes, gravel, or fabric. A basic repair with standard materials might be around $500, whereas high-end materials can push costs toward $1,200 or more. Material choice impacts the overall project budget.
Labor Fees - Labor charges for drainage system repairs generally range from $50 to $150 per hour, with total costs depending on project size and complexity. A straightforward repair may take a few hours, costing approximately $300, while larger projects could require several days of work, increasing costs accordingly. Local contractor rates vary across York County and nearby areas.
Additional Expenses - Extra costs such as permits, site preparation, or cleanup can add $200 to $800 to the overall expense. For instance, obtaining necessary permits might cost around $150, and site restoration could be about $300. These additional expenses depend on project specifics and local regulations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of drainage problems in a landscape? Indicators include standing water, erosion, soggy areas, or uneven ground after rainfall.
How can landscape drainage issues be repaired? Local service providers may use methods like installing drainage pipes, French drains, or grading adjustments to improve water flow.
Is professional repair necessary for drainage problems? Yes, consulting experienced contractors can ensure effective solutions tailored to specific landscape conditions.
What factors influence the choice of drainage repair methods? Soil type, landscape layout, and water flow patterns typically determine the most suitable repair approach.
How long do landscape drainage repairs usually last? Durability depends on the repair method and maintenance, but properly installed solutions can provide long-term results.
